We have lots to be proud of today at Campbell High School!  We would like to send a big SHOUT OUT to the following for outstanding representation of Campbell High School!

~The Spartan Swim and Dive Team had outstanding results at the Cobb Championship Meet this past weekend!
For Diving:
Addie Howser took 4th place, Dalton Isley took 6th, and David Bullock (who was very sick) took 4th, set a new school record and had an All American score!
For Swimming:
Cody Kanter, Dalton Isley, Mia Price, Sydney Reynolds, and Alex Cross all made finals in the Meet for individual events!
The boys 200 Medley Relay swam by Cody Kanter, Devin Alexander, Dalton Isley, and Jaco Janse Van Rensburg tied the school record.
The girls 200 Medley Relay swam by Maya Hughes, Mia Price, Savannah Sheats, and Sydney Reynolds set a new school record.
The girls 200 Free Relay swam by Mia Price, Catherine Garmong, Maya Hughes, and Sydney Reynolds set a new school record.
The girls 400 Free Relay swam by Sydney Reynolds, Savananh Sheats, Maya Hughes, and Mia Price not only set a new school record at Friday's Prelims but smashed their own record at Saturday's finals!

~The boys varsity basketball team recorded a big upset victory on Friday night at Marietta 57-49. Laz Walker led the scoring with 18 points, followed by Dom Klein with 15 and Mike Olmert continued his fine play with 12 points and 2 steals, Jequan Ward added 3 steals and 5 assists.  Way to go Spartans!

~Congratulations goes to the Campbell HS JROTC Drill Team/Color Guard in their 1st meet of the season at Jackson County High School in Jefferson, Georgia in the following events:
Unarmed Knockout – Devin Bradberry – 3rd Place
Female Color Guard commanded by Isela Yanez – 3rd Place
Female Unarmed Squad commanded by Audriana Lyons – 3rd Place
Male Armed Squad commanded by Chris Williams – 3rd Place
Male Unarmed Platoon commanded by Brandon Daniels – 2nd Place
Male Armed Platoon commanded by Dray Cathey – 2nd Place
Female Unarmed Platoon commanded by Abbey Sandoval – 2nd Place
Female Armed Platoon commanded by Tabitha Gamache – 2nd Place
Female Armed Squad commanded by Tabitha Gamache – 2nd Place
Male Unarmed Squad commanded by Deonte Compton – 1st Place
The team placed 2nd overall, your dedication and commitment always represents Campbell High School as a school of excellence, you continue to always make us proud!
